Spec comparison
| Spec | Suzuki GS 1000 GL | Suzuki GS 1000 G |
|---|---|---|
| Model year | 1981 | 1981 |
| Price | — | — |
| Engine | 997 cc | 997 cc |
| Horsepower | 90 hp | 90 hp |
| Fuel capacity | 4.0 L | 5.3 L |
| Fuel type | petrol | petrol |
| Transmission | 5-speed | 5-speed |
| Front brakes | Dual disc | Dual disc |
| Rear brakes | Single disc | Single disc |
| Tires | 3.50-19 / 4.50-17 | 3.50-19 / 4.50-17 |
